The reason behind chemotherapy drugs side effects

Chemotherapy drugs cause side effects because they attack cells dividing quickly, without distinguishing between cancer cells and healthy cells which also divide rapidly (hair cells, blood cells, and cells in the mouth and intestines). This can lead to side effects. These side effects are usually temporary, because healthy cells can repair themselves or be replaced.
